mirror of
https://github.com/Lastorder-DC/rhymix.git
synced 2026-05-10 04:24:14 +09:00
git-svn-id: http://xe-core.googlecode.com/svn/trunk@185 201d5d3c-b55e-5fd7-737f-ddc643e51545
This commit is contained in:
parent
282349d055
commit
f2eb342618
5 changed files with 32 additions and 66 deletions
|
|
@ -506,19 +506,13 @@
|
||||||
|
|
||||||
// 전체 가입항목 목록을 구한다
|
// 전체 가입항목 목록을 구한다
|
||||||
$join_form_list = $oMemberModel->getJoinFormList();
|
$join_form_list = $oMemberModel->getJoinFormList();
|
||||||
if(count($join_form_list->data)) {
|
$join_form_srl_list = array_keys($join_form_list);
|
||||||
foreach($join_form_list->data as $key => $val) {
|
|
||||||
$join_form_srl_list[] = $val->member_join_form_srl;
|
|
||||||
}
|
|
||||||
}
|
|
||||||
if(count($join_form_srl_list)<2) return new Object();
|
if(count($join_form_srl_list)<2) return new Object();
|
||||||
|
|
||||||
$prev_category = NULL;
|
$prev_member_join_form = NULL;
|
||||||
if(count($join_form_list->data)) {
|
foreach($join_form_list as $key => $val) {
|
||||||
foreach($join_form_list->data as $key => $val) {
|
if($val->member_join_form_srl == $member_join_form_srl) break;
|
||||||
if($val->member_join_form_srl == $member_join_form_srl) break;
|
$prev_member_join_form = $val;
|
||||||
$prev_member_join_form = $val;
|
|
||||||
}
|
|
||||||
}
|
}
|
||||||
|
|
||||||
// 이전 가입항목가 없으면 그냥 return
|
// 이전 가입항목가 없으면 그냥 return
|
||||||
|
|
@ -527,13 +521,16 @@
|
||||||
// 선택한 가입항목의 정보
|
// 선택한 가입항목의 정보
|
||||||
$cur_args->member_join_form_srl = $member_join_form_srl;
|
$cur_args->member_join_form_srl = $member_join_form_srl;
|
||||||
$cur_args->list_order = $prev_member_join_form->list_order;
|
$cur_args->list_order = $prev_member_join_form->list_order;
|
||||||
$output = $oDB->executeQuery('member.updateMemberJoinFormListorder', $cur_args);
|
|
||||||
if(!$output->toBool()) return $output;
|
|
||||||
|
|
||||||
// 대상 가입항목의 정보
|
// 대상 가입항목의 정보
|
||||||
$prev_args->member_join_form_srl = $prev_member_join_form->member_join_form_srl;
|
$prev_args->member_join_form_srl = $prev_member_join_form->member_join_form_srl;
|
||||||
$prev_args->list_order = $list_order;
|
$prev_args->list_order = $list_order;
|
||||||
$oDB->executeQuery('member.updateMemberJoinFormListorder', $cur_args);
|
|
||||||
|
// DB 처리
|
||||||
|
$output = $oDB->executeQuery('member.updateMemberJoinFormListorder', $cur_args);
|
||||||
|
if(!$output->toBool()) return $output;
|
||||||
|
|
||||||
|
$oDB->executeQuery('member.updateMemberJoinFormListorder', $prev_args);
|
||||||
if(!$output->toBool()) return $output;
|
if(!$output->toBool()) return $output;
|
||||||
|
|
||||||
return new Object();
|
return new Object();
|
||||||
|
|
@ -556,11 +553,7 @@
|
||||||
|
|
||||||
// 전체 가입항목 목록을 구한다
|
// 전체 가입항목 목록을 구한다
|
||||||
$join_form_list = $oMemberModel->getJoinFormList();
|
$join_form_list = $oMemberModel->getJoinFormList();
|
||||||
if(count($join_form_list->data)) {
|
$join_form_srl_list = array_keys($join_form_list);
|
||||||
foreach($join_form_list->data as $key => $val) {
|
|
||||||
$join_form_srl_list[] = $val->member_join_form_srl;
|
|
||||||
}
|
|
||||||
}
|
|
||||||
if(count($join_form_srl_list)<2) return new Object();
|
if(count($join_form_srl_list)<2) return new Object();
|
||||||
|
|
||||||
for($i=0;$i<count($join_form_srl_list);$i++) {
|
for($i=0;$i<count($join_form_srl_list);$i++) {
|
||||||
|
|
@ -571,23 +564,21 @@
|
||||||
|
|
||||||
// 이전 가입항목가 없으면 그냥 return
|
// 이전 가입항목가 없으면 그냥 return
|
||||||
if(!$next_member_join_form_srl) return new Object();
|
if(!$next_member_join_form_srl) return new Object();
|
||||||
foreach($join_form_list->data as $key => $val) {
|
$next_member_join_form = $join_form_list[$next_member_join_form_srl];
|
||||||
if($val->member_join_form_srl == $next_member_join_form_srl) {
|
|
||||||
$next_member_join_form = $val;
|
|
||||||
break;
|
|
||||||
}
|
|
||||||
}
|
|
||||||
|
|
||||||
// 선택한 가입항목의 정보
|
// 선택한 가입항목의 정보
|
||||||
$cur_args->member_join_form_srl = $member_join_form_srl;
|
$cur_args->member_join_form_srl = $member_join_form_srl;
|
||||||
$cur_args->list_order = $next_member_join_form->list_order;
|
$cur_args->list_order = $next_member_join_form->list_order;
|
||||||
$output = $oDB->executeQuery('member.updateMemberJoinFormListorder', $cur_args);
|
|
||||||
if(!$output->toBool()) return $output;
|
|
||||||
|
|
||||||
// 대상 가입항목의 정보
|
// 대상 가입항목의 정보
|
||||||
$next_args->member_join_form_srl = $next_member_join_form->member_join_form_srl;
|
$next_args->member_join_form_srl = $next_member_join_form->member_join_form_srl;
|
||||||
$next_args->list_order = $list_order;
|
$next_args->list_order = $list_order;
|
||||||
$oDB->executeQuery('member.updateMemberJoinFormListorder', $cur_args);
|
|
||||||
|
// DB 처리
|
||||||
|
$output = $oDB->executeQuery('member.updateMemberJoinFormListorder', $cur_args);
|
||||||
|
if(!$output->toBool()) return $output;
|
||||||
|
|
||||||
|
$output = $oDB->executeQuery('member.updateMemberJoinFormListorder', $next_args);
|
||||||
if(!$output->toBool()) return $output;
|
if(!$output->toBool()) return $output;
|
||||||
|
|
||||||
return new Object();
|
return new Object();
|
||||||
|
|
|
||||||
|
|
@ -204,12 +204,18 @@
|
||||||
$oDB = &DB::getInstance();
|
$oDB = &DB::getInstance();
|
||||||
|
|
||||||
$args->sort_index = "list_order";
|
$args->sort_index = "list_order";
|
||||||
$args->page = Context::get('page');
|
|
||||||
$args->list_count = 40;
|
|
||||||
$args->page_count = 10;
|
|
||||||
|
|
||||||
$output = $oDB->executeQuery('member.getJoinFormList', $args);
|
$output = $oDB->executeQuery('member.getJoinFormList', $args);
|
||||||
return $output;
|
$join_form_list = $output->data;
|
||||||
|
|
||||||
|
if(!$join_form_list) return NULL;
|
||||||
|
|
||||||
|
if(!is_array($join_form_list)) $join_form_list = array($join_form_list);
|
||||||
|
$join_form_count = count($join_form_list);
|
||||||
|
for($i=0;$i<$join_form_count;$i++) {
|
||||||
|
$member_join_form_srl = $join_form_list[$i]->member_join_form_srl;
|
||||||
|
$list[$member_join_form_srl] = $join_form_list[$i];
|
||||||
|
}
|
||||||
|
return $list;
|
||||||
}
|
}
|
||||||
|
|
||||||
/**
|
/**
|
||||||
|
|
|
||||||
|
|
@ -101,13 +101,8 @@
|
||||||
$oMemberModel = &getModel('member');
|
$oMemberModel = &getModel('member');
|
||||||
|
|
||||||
// 사용금지 목록 가져오기
|
// 사용금지 목록 가져오기
|
||||||
$output = $oMemberModel->getJoinFormList();
|
$form_list = $oMemberModel->getJoinFormList();
|
||||||
|
Context::set('form_list', $form_list);
|
||||||
Context::set('total_count', $output->total_count);
|
|
||||||
Context::set('total_page', $output->total_page);
|
|
||||||
Context::set('page', $output->page);
|
|
||||||
Context::set('form_list', $output->data);
|
|
||||||
Context::set('page_navigation', $output->page_navigation);
|
|
||||||
|
|
||||||
$this->setTemplateFile('join_form_list');
|
$this->setTemplateFile('join_form_list');
|
||||||
}
|
}
|
||||||
|
|
|
||||||
|
|
@ -7,8 +7,5 @@
|
||||||
</columns>
|
</columns>
|
||||||
<navigation>
|
<navigation>
|
||||||
<index var="sort_index" default="list_order" order="asc" />
|
<index var="sort_index" default="list_order" order="asc" />
|
||||||
<list_count var="list_count" default="20" />
|
|
||||||
<page_count var="page_count" default="10" />
|
|
||||||
<page var="page" default="1" />
|
|
||||||
</navigation>
|
</navigation>
|
||||||
</query>
|
</query>
|
||||||
|
|
|
||||||
|
|
@ -7,17 +7,10 @@
|
||||||
<input type="hidden" name="mode" value="" />
|
<input type="hidden" name="mode" value="" />
|
||||||
</form>
|
</form>
|
||||||
|
|
||||||
<!-- 정보 -->
|
|
||||||
<div>
|
|
||||||
{number_format($total_count)},
|
|
||||||
{$lang->page_count} : {number_format($page)} / {number_format($total_page)}
|
|
||||||
</div>
|
|
||||||
|
|
||||||
<!-- 목록 -->
|
<!-- 목록 -->
|
||||||
<div>
|
<div>
|
||||||
<table>
|
<table>
|
||||||
<tr>
|
<tr>
|
||||||
<th>{$lang->no}</th>
|
|
||||||
<th>{$lang->column_type}</th>
|
<th>{$lang->column_type}</th>
|
||||||
<th>{$lang->column_title}</th>
|
<th>{$lang->column_title}</th>
|
||||||
<th>{$lang->column_name}</th>
|
<th>{$lang->column_name}</th>
|
||||||
|
|
@ -28,7 +21,6 @@
|
||||||
</tr>
|
</tr>
|
||||||
<!--@foreach($form_list as $no => $val)-->
|
<!--@foreach($form_list as $no => $val)-->
|
||||||
<tr>
|
<tr>
|
||||||
<td>{$no}</td>
|
|
||||||
<td>{$lang->column_type_list[$val->column_type]}</td>
|
<td>{$lang->column_type_list[$val->column_type]}</td>
|
||||||
<td>{$val->column_title}</td>
|
<td>{$val->column_title}</td>
|
||||||
<td>{$val->column_name}</td>
|
<td>{$val->column_name}</td>
|
||||||
|
|
@ -48,18 +40,3 @@
|
||||||
[<a href="#" onclick="location.href='{getUrl('act','dispInsertJoinForm')}';return false;">{$lang->cmd_make}</a>]
|
[<a href="#" onclick="location.href='{getUrl('act','dispInsertJoinForm')}';return false;">{$lang->cmd_make}</a>]
|
||||||
|
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
<!-- 페이지 네비게이션 -->
|
|
||||||
<div>
|
|
||||||
<a href="{getUrl('page','','member_srl','')}">[{$lang->first_page}]</a>
|
|
||||||
|
|
||||||
<!--@while($page_no = $page_navigation->getNextPage())-->
|
|
||||||
<!--@if($page == $page_no)-->
|
|
||||||
{$page_no}
|
|
||||||
<!--@else-->
|
|
||||||
<a href="{getUrl('page',$page_no,'member_srl','')}">[{$page_no}]</a>
|
|
||||||
<!--@end-->
|
|
||||||
<!--@end-->
|
|
||||||
|
|
||||||
<a href="{getUrl('page',$page_navigation->last_page,'member_srl','')}">[{$lang->last_page}]</a>
|
|
||||||
</div>
|
|
||||||
|
|
|
||||||
Loading…
Add table
Add a link
Reference in a new issue